Fri13 Posted March 29, 2021 Share Posted March 29, 2021 5 hours ago, Baltic Pirate said: Thats some serious kit you have there. Like that. Mi-8 Kord shooter is nice to be. It is amazing thing when you have a competent pilot to circle around the targets at 1000-1500 meters and you get to nail them on the ground. In Mi-24P it likely will be as well a great experience, especially if we can switch the side where to shoot. The capabilities changes a lot when you can begin with the ATGM launches to take down possible high threat AA units like M6 Linebacker or Grotale, and then pilot switch to S-8 rockets to saturate the possible lighter MANPADS defense positions and maybe pick some APC's out that has 20-30 mm cannons with the 30 mm cannon while at the attack. Finally to become flying around the target zone where door gunner get to destroy trucks, APC's and some other lighter vehicles. Now think about the experience when six Mi-24P's are doing it, and you get to jump between co-pilot, pilot and then door gunner and have such control device in your hands.
